Typical medium theory for disordered electronic systems on simple lattices with Cauchy distribution of on-site potentialsAndreas Ostlin1, Hanna Terletska2, Dylan Jones1, and •Liviu Chioncel1,31Institute of Physics, University of Augsburg, Augsburg, Germany — 2Middle Tennessee State University, Murfreesboro, Tennessee, USA — 3ACIT, University of Augsburg, Augsburg, Germany

Effective medium approaches using single-site averaging procedures of various kinds contributed substantially in understanding the density of states of electronically disordered systems in models and materials. The nature and the conditions for appearance of single-particle (Anderson) localization seems to be qualitatively understood, yet discussions concerning special applied methods and quantitative results for the critical conditions are still ongoing. Here we present results using the typical medium theory for the one-particle and two-particle Green’s function (conductivities) for the special case of Cauchy-distribution.
